🍁 金秋送福,大獎轉不停!Gate 廣場第 1️⃣ 3️⃣ 期秋季成長值抽獎大狂歡開啓!
總獎池超 $15,000+,iPhone 17 Pro Max、Gate 精美週邊、大額合約體驗券等你來抽!
立即抽獎 👉 https://www.gate.com/activities/pointprize/?now_period=13&refUid=13129053
💡 如何攢成長值,解鎖更多抽獎機會?
1️⃣ 進入【廣場】,點頭像旁標識進入【社區中心】
2️⃣ 完成發帖、評論、點讚、社群發言等日常任務,成長值拿不停
100% 必中,手氣再差也不虧,手氣爆棚就能抱走大獎,趕緊試試手氣!
詳情: https://www.gate.com/announcements/article/47381
#成长值抽奖赢iPhone17和精美周边# #BONK# #BTC# #ETH# #GT#
在元宇宙虚拟演唱会中,5000名观众同时在线,每人都穿戴了一件具有实时布料模拟效果的虚拟服装。这种场景对计算性能提出了巨大挑战。传统的CPU方案在处理2万个粒子时需要20毫秒,导致帧率骤降至45fps,严重影响用户体验,尤其是在DeFi交易等时间敏感的操作中。
为解决这一问题,开发团队提出了三项优化策略:首先,将粒子间距增加到10厘米,有效减少了75%的粒子数量;其次,完全关闭自碰撞检测,帧率提升35%;最后,采用ComputeShader整体打包处理,将GPU处理时间压缩到0.5毫秒。
在技术实现中,团队还采用了一些巧妙的方法。例如,在HLSL代码中注释掉自碰撞检测,通过Avatar圆柱体来模拟碰撞效果。这种方法虽然在视觉上有微小误差,但用户几乎无法察觉,同时大幅提升了性能,使链下GPU能够稳定运行在120fps。
为了确保跨平台一致性和去中心化,开发者将关键参数如弯曲刚度和拉伸刚度嵌入到glTF的自定义段中。这些参数在NFT铸造时被写入,使得任何引擎都能准确复现相同的物理效果,无需中心化授权。
最终,优化后的方案在性能上取得了显著提升。相比传统CPU方案的2万粒子、20毫秒GPU时间和45fps帧率,新方案仅使用5000个粒子,GPU处理时间降至0.5毫秒,帧率提升到120fps。在iPhone 13上的实测中,仅导致0.5毫秒的延迟和1.2℃的轻微发热,用户体验几乎无感。
这一系列优化不仅提高了虚拟演唱会的视觉质量和流畅度,还为Web3生态中的其他高性能应用开辟了新的可能性。